Simul-Frac Market Analysis
Simul-Frac, or simultaneous fracturing, is an advanced hydraulic fracturing technique that optimizes oil and gas extraction by stimulating multiple wellbore sections simultaneously. **Simul-Frac Market Overview**
The Simul-Frac market is a crucial segment within the oil and gas industry, especially for shale and conventional oil extraction. It comprises software and hardware that enhance the efficiency and effectiveness of hydraulic fracturing operations. The software segment includes simulation tools, allowing operators to model and optimize fracture behavior, while hardware includes advanced equipment designed for real-time data collection and analysis.
The market is primarily segmented into applications for shale oil and conventional oil, with each requiring tailored technologies to address distinct geological and operational challenges. Shale oil applications typically demand more sophisticated techniques due to the complexity of shale formations.

Simul-Frac Segment Analysis
Simul-Frac Market, by Application:
Simul-Frac technology is utilized in shale oil and conventional oil extraction to optimize hydraulic fracturing operations. By simultaneously injecting fluids into multiple fractures, Simul-Frac enhances the efficiency of resource recovery, minimizing time and costs. It allows operators to achieve better reservoir drainage and ensure more uniform fracture propagation.
